The Metals:

 

CoT Reports: Gold | Silver

 

Gold traded mostly slightly higher in Asia and London before it came into New York slightly lower, but it then rose throughout most of trade in New York and ended near its highs with a gain of 1.37%.  Silver seesawed its way higher throughout trade in Asia, London, and New York and ended near its highs with a gain of 1.10%.

 

Euro gold rose near €515, platinum lost $1 to $1,194, palladium gained $3 to $340, and copper rose over 7 cents to $2.50.

 

Gold and silver equities rose about 1.5% by early afternoon, but they then fell off into the close along with the major indices and ended with slight losses despite the over 1% gains in the metals on Friday.

 

The Economy:

 

Fed members Poole, Pianalto, and Fisher all spoke today and would not rule out future interest rate hikes as fed governor Bies announced her retirement in March.

The Markets:

 

Charts Courtesy of http://finance.yahoo.com/

 

Oil rose over $60 before pulling back slightly as Nigeria declared a force majeure to join Occidental Petroleum’s force majeure in California, OPEC lowered exports, cold weather continued in the U.S., and Iran declared attacks on U.S. interests around the world should it be attacked.

 

The U.S. dollar index rose on fed speak and on the view that the G7 meeting will not call for a stronger yen as previously thought earlier in the week.

 

Treasuries fell on profit taking from gains earlier in the week and on comments from fed members speaking about possible interest rate hikes.

 

The Dow, Nasdaq, and S&P fell as oil rose near $60, mortgage stocks fell markedly, Micron warned at its analyst meeting, and fed comments raised worries over higher interest rates.

The Commentary:

 

“*Gold broke out of a minor bullish pennant formation to the upside, another positive technical development.

 

*The move up today confirms the EXTREME IMPORTANCE of the information brought to your attention yesterday regarding central bank buying. No sense rehashing the analysis, except to say the gold market cannot handle reduced ECB group selling, while other central banks are stepping up to the plate to buy.

 

*The gold open interest rose 5283 contracts to 366,189. This leaves that OI only 7,000 contracts below its multi-decade high. With today’s stunning reversal breakout, we are getting very close to another signal failure … the kind which occurred when gold rose from $436 to $730, following GATA’s Gold Rush 21 in the Yukon, our conference attended by Andrey Bykov, an economic advisor to Russian President Vladimir Putin.”- From yesterday’s Midas report by Bill Murphy of LemetropoleCafe.com

 

“April Gold finished up 9.5 at 672.3, 1.2 off the high and 10 up from the low.

 

March Silver closed up 0.145 at 13.915. This was 0.095 up from the low and 0.055 off the high.

 

Crude oil trading above $60 per barrel may have been the initial catalyst to drive gold higher this morning, but gold seemed to take on a life of its own as it held its gains despite some mid-morning weakness in crude. In the end, gold made significant gains on the day, with April gold trading to its highest level since August despite nearby crude oil struggling with the $60 level. The US Dollar appeared to have little bearing on the market, as it stayed inside yesterday's range throughout the session. Comments by the Managing Director of the IMF stating that the agency could sell a limited amount of gold reserves to increase its source of income were mitigated by his assertion that it would be only part of a larger funding plan and should not disrupt the metals markets.

 

Like gold, silver made some impressive gains on the day that were initially brought about by strength in the crude oil market. Dollar action appeared to have little impact on the market today, but the market probably found support from higher copper and platinum prices as well as from fund buying, as the major trend in silver continues to be consistently strong. A pattern of higher lows would seem to leave the bias in silver pointing upward, even if the market is a bit short term overbought.”- The Hightower Report, Futures Analysis and Forecasting

NovaGold's Galore Creek Project Update - "NovaGold Resources Inc. (Toronto:NG.TO - News)(AMEX:NG - News) today reported that its Galore Creek copper-gold-silver project in northwestern British Columbia is rapidly advancing toward the start of construction in the second quarter of 2007, upon receipt of permits. The project is in the last stages of permitting, with the final public comment and review period underway. Final assay results from the 2006 drilling program have been received, and a resource update is targeted for the end of the first quarter." More

Newmont trial in Indonesia postponed for two weeks - "An Indonesian court hearing due on Friday for a high-profile pollution trial involving U.S. firm Newmont Mining Corp. (NEM.N: Quote, Profile , Research) has been postponed for two weeks, officials said.

A Newmont unit operating in Indonesia's North Sulawesi province and its president director, Richard Ness, face charges over allegations the miner dumped toxic substances near its now defunct gold mine, making villagers sick." More
